Design No:
|
IC0618
|
|
Vessel Name:
|
Seacor Cougar, Seacor Cheetah
|
|
A revolutionary crew vessel capable of speeds in excess of 40 knots. Replaces heli transfer or multiple vessel operations due to its high speed, reliability and sea keeping. DP2 capability with DP weather envelope superior to any other vessel in this size range. Vessels deployed Angola and Azerbaijan with additional vessels under development.
